A Voice on the Wind, and Other Poems

Madison Julius Cawein's poetry collection, "A Voice on the Wind, and Other Poems," captivates readers with its lush imagery and lyrical elegance. The collection encompasses themes of nature, love, and introspection, often mirroring the late Romantic literary style that drew heavily on the beauty of the American landscape. Cawein masterfully intertwines personal sentiment with the grandeur of the environment, inviting readers to traverse the vivid landscapes of the heart and mind. His use of rich, emotive language serves as a testament to both his technical prowess and deep understanding of the natural world's influence on human experience. Cawein, known as the "Poet of the Bluegrass," was deeply influenced by his Kentucky upbringing, where the landscapes of rural America served as both muse and metaphor. His dedication to capturing the intricate relationship between nature and emotion is a hallmark of his work, showcasing his desire to connect readers with the profound beauty that solitude and nature can provide. Cawein's extensive involvement in the literary community of his time also shaped his artistic voice, allowing him to engage with contemporary themes while maintaining his unique style. Readers of poetry will find "A Voice on the Wind, and Other Poems" an essential exploration of the tonal depth and emotional resonance inherent in the human experience. Cawein's ability to transport audiences to serene vistas and evoke visceral emotions makes this collection a noteworthy addition to any literary repertoire. Whether one seeks solace, reflection, or inspiration, this work stands as a vivid reminder of the transformative power of poetry.
